ASOS
ASOS was established in 2000 with fashionable shopper in their twenties as its main target market. The company initially sought to raise startup funds by selling cheap copies of fashions worn by celebrities such as Sienna Miller and Kate Moss. However, a year later the founders Nick Robertson and Susanne Clarke decided to focus on clothing as this would generate the highest returns.
The ASOS website offers a wide selection of sizes and products, including maternity and plus size clothing, accessories, shoes, and stationary. It also features a range of style guides and #AsSeenOnMe posts to inspire. Customers can also add items to their wish list and create private boards to organize their favorites.
The ASOS mobile app offers a seamless shopping environment, including the synchronization of your saved items and quick checkout. The app also shows inventory information, which can help keep customers from disappointment when items are out of stock. This is an excellent illustration of how retailers can make use of online shopping to increase customer engagement and increase loyalty.
George at ASDA
Founded in 1989, George is Asda's supermarket fashion brand with clothes for women, men and children. George offers a range of affordable and ethically sourced clothing. Customers can buy clothing online, in over 500 Asda shops, as well as on the George website.
The new collection is a part of the 'quiet luxury' style, with pieces made from silk, cotton and linen blends. The line features slouchy suiting and ribbed knit separates and printed co-ords. Prices start at 12 pounds (for a 100% Supima Cotton T-shirt) and increase to around 77 pounds (for complete suits).
As a fast-fashion retailer, ASDA George creates new store planograms and directives "generally every six weeks". Visual Retailing's software for retail planning is employed by the company to modernise its planning process and ensure it is future-proof. It can now send visual merchandising design and briefs at a rate that is unprecedented, efficiency, and simplicity. StyleShoots is a multi-purpose photo machine, removes garments from the background and uploads them into Visual Retailing for immediate use in VM Layouts. This aids in enhancing merchandising compliance and ensure that all its stores receive the identical information.
Debenhams
Debenhams, one of the most storied UK department store chains offers a variety of clothing and other products. It has a variety of brands, and also regular sales and discounts. The company also provides various services to help customers find the products they are looking for.
The first store opened in London in 1778, as a drapers' store. In the past, it has grown into a huge chain of department stores with a global presence. It is a leading fashion retailer, known for its exclusive brands and designer clothing. It has a large online presence.
While some Debenhams stores have closed due to the COVID-19 epidemic, it has continued to operate online. The company recently sold its brand and websites to Boohoo Group for PS55 million. This acquisition demonstrates the growing power shift away from brick-and mortar retailers to their more agile online counterparts. This trend is expected continue as sales at physical stores continue to fall.
